Best 64465 Missouri Public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 921 students in 64465, MO.
The top-ranked public schools in 64465, MO are Lathrop High School, Lathrop Middle School and Lathrop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 64465 have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the Missouri public school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 49% (versus the 43% statewide average). Schools in 64465, MO have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Missouri public schools.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Missouri public school average of 32% (majority Black).
